A BILL
TO REPEAL SECTION 41-27-525 OF THE 1976 CODE, RELATING TO THE AVAILABILITY OF UNEMPLOYMENT BENEFITS FOR PERSONS SEEKING ONLY PART-TIME WORK.
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ina:
SECTION 1. Section 41-27-525 of the 1976 Code is repealed.
SECTION 2. This act takes effect upon approval by the Governor.
